  • Clun Castle: A fascinating ruin located 8.0km from Bishops Castle, Clun Castle exudes rich cultural vibes, inviting visitors to explore its historical remnants and enjoy the picturesque landscape.
  • Powis Castle and Garden: Situated 20.9km away, this stunning castle and its romantic gardens offer a delightful blend of history and beauty, perfect for a leisurely stroll among vibrant flora.
  • Shropshire Hills: Just 8.0km from Bishops Castle, the Shropshire Hills provide breathtaking scenery and outdoor adventures, making it an ideal spot for hiking and soaking in nature.

Best time to go to Bishops Castle

If you're planning a trip to Bishops Castle, it's a good idea to check both the weather and property rates. The warmest month is July.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January38.3°F (3.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verage
February39.4°F (4.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verage
March41.9°F (5.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verage
April45.9°F (7.7°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ly CloudySlightly High
May51.3°F (10.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verage
June56.8°F (13.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verage
July60.1°F (15.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ly High
August59.4°F (15.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verage
September55.8°F (13.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ly High
October50.5°F (10.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ly Low
November44.1°F (6.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ly Low
December40.5°F (4.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ly Low
